Birthdate on World War I Registration: 8 June 1889
Birthdate on World War II Registration: 9 June 1889
1910 United States Census: with Aloysius and Theresia in South Dakota
1920 United States Census: at 1323 Moore Street, Bellingham, Whatcom County, Washington, Ward 3; Married; with May, Constance, and mother Theresia; Laborer in Lumber Mill
1930 United States Census: at Custer, Whatcom County, Washington with May and "Constant"; occupation: Merchant/Grocery store owner
1940 United States Census: at Custer, Whatcom County, Washington with May; occupation: Retail Grocery proprietor (Recorded as William A. Meris and May Meris)
Observe 40th Anniversary:
Many friends greeted Mr. and Mrs. W. A. Meyer Thursday afternoon and evening on their 40th wedding anniversary. Assisting them in receiving at their home were their daughter, Mrs. Chris Jensen and their granddaughter and her husband, Mr. and Mrs. Don Smith who are visiting here from Columbus, Ohio. The couple also has a grandson, ronnie Jensen. The anniversary cake which was served with coffee was decorated in Ruby rosebuds in recognition of the ruby anniversary. With her black dress and red carnation corsage, Mrs. Meyer wore a long necklace of seed pearls and onyx, a gift to her from Mr. Meyer on her wedding day. An arrangement of talisman and red rosebuds centered the table. Many gifts and cards were received by the couple, including a telegram from their son-in-law who is in Alaska. Mr. and Mrs. Meyer have been residents of Bellingham for many years. They were married here in June 1915.
